What is the number one thing preventing you from achieving your goals?
The number one thing that based on my perception that is preventing people from not only achieving their goals but even pursuing their goals is getting caught up in life. In general it seems as though everyone gets so caught up in the day to day operations and that becomes life for them. The regimented schedule of work, home, dinner, TV and repeat becomes what life is about. There is no fire or fury to pursue more and if there is a fire to pursue more, it gets smothered out my the fire extinguisher known as complacency. Also all of the issues surrounding individuals lives become their life. The everyday stress over bills, or issues with a relationship partner or any issue that in the big scheme of life isn't that big becomes their primary focus. Many people I have come in contact with will talk for hours about these issues or perceived problems in their lives and allow these issues to dictate the movements in their life. What I mean by that is that they are allowing these issues to consume them and take the focus off of a goal and put it onto the problem and what happens is that that mental approach becomes a habit and before you know it when one problem is resolved here comes another one to take it's place. It becomes a never ending cycle of complaints and excuses. The excuses stem from the wanting of the end result of whatever that goal is but the lack of the drive to put in the work that is required. The fact is that in order to do something extraordinary you have to put in extra ordinary work. The majority of goals cannot be accomplished with part time effort. If you want to do something that no one else has done then you have to put work in like no one else has. Period. Now don't get me wrong this is not an indictment on anyone but just a statement of reality that I think many people are not aware of or willing to face. We see it everyday people talking about how much they want things and then going home and sit on the couch. The only difference between you and most of the people or lifestyles you want to emulate is that those people made a decision. A decision that they are going to give themselves one option, and that option is to succeed.  Â
